119th CONGRESS
1st Session
H. R. 3878

To amend title XVIII of the Social Security Act to ensure adequate
coverage of annual wellness visits at rural health clinics under the
Medicare program.

_______________________________________________________________________

IN TH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ES

June 10, 2025

Mrs. Hinson (for herself and Ms. Scholten) introduced the following
bill; which was referred to the Committee on Energy and Commerce, and
in addition to the Committee on Ways and Means, for a period to be
subsequently determined by the Speaker, in each case for consideration
of such provisions as fall within the jurisdiction of the committee
concerned

_______________________________________________________________________

A BILL

To amend title XVIII of the Social Security Act to ensure adequate
coverage of annual wellness visits at rural health clinics under the
Medicare program.

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1.

This Act may be cited as the ``RNs for Rural Health Act of 2025''.
SEC. 2.
